The Indiana Department of Transportation announces ongoing lane closures on U.S. 231 northbound north of Cloverdale.
Traffic on U.S. 231 northbound is being directed to the southbound lane with flagging operations in place. Southbound traffic will remain in place. This will allow for crews to complete added turn lanes in the area, as part of a project that started last year.
Construction is anticipated to be complete by mid-July but is weather-dependent and is subject to change. INDOT encourages drivers to use caution while traveling through this and all work zones.
